Solution

The correct option is B magnitude of velocity is constant but the direction of velocity change
Let the car describes an angle θ radian in time t second.
Angular velocity w=θt rad/s
Thus its linear velocity v=rw=rθt=constant
As the linear velocity is tangential to the circular motion, thus it changes its direction at every instant.
